As regards agricultural issues, the Council will hold several debates concerning the common agricultural policy (CAP) reform package, which includes regulations on:
These debates should pave the way for a Council position on the CAP reform, expected to be established in March, and the forthcoming negotiations with the European Parliament on this issue.
In addition, the Council will discuss the fraudulent use of horsemeat instead of beef in the food chain.
On fisheries issues, the Council will seek to reach a general approach to the regulation on the Common Fisheries Policy, aimed at ensuring sustainable management of fishery resources and contributing to the availability of food supplies.
Finally the Commission will report on the state of play of the negotiations with Morocco for the establishment of a fisheries partnership agreement.
